As you begin planning, it’s important to consider what power is available at your venue. Some venues have accessible outlets or dedicated power sources that can support an LED screen setup, while others—especially outdoor or open field locations—may not have power readily available.

LED screens require a consistent and reliable power source to operate properly. This typically means more than just a standard outlet, depending on the size of the screen and the setup. That’s why it’s helpful to plan for power early, alongside your screen size and layout.

If your venue does have power available, we’ll work with you to confirm that it meets the requirements for your specific setup. If not, no problem—we can provide generators as part of your rental. This ensures your screen runs smoothly no matter the location, without you having to coordinate additional vendors.
